Description
Inspired by the foods and lifestyle of California's wine country, The Sonoma Diet is a weight loss plan based on wholesome, satisfying, flavorful meals. Instead of depriving you of the balanced nourishment you need, The Sonoma Diet emphasizes readily available Power Foods (like whole grain breads and sweet berries) that deliver heart-protective nutrients with a minimum of calories, eaten in combinations that boost health benefits, flavor, and weight loss success.--From publisher description.
